Output 95dca167db310b51b5e0392240d9e2c740eab11162725ec8b8c14bc736180abd:1

value
4395824
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 500094e323d2cf48898baae693e440a612ad124c OP_EQUALVERIFY OP_CHECKSIG
address
18J1kkrSaBfLvv2HB6fK8gHVpEXxf45jJi
transaction
95dca167db310b51b5e0392240d9e2c740eab11162725ec8b8c14bc736180abd
confirmations
461501
spent
true